Transaction 2370f33f7036a8d6476bed02e34d35dfe2864e38a0eec43da9520727f389ee2e

1 Input
2 Outputs
  • 2370f33f7036a8d6476bed02e34d35dfe2864e38a0eec43da9520727f389ee2e:0
  • value  5593069
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 2370f33f7036a8d6476bed02e34d35dfe2864e38a0eec43da9520727f389ee2e:1
  • value  884000
    address  37o8gVFbjqGaHBNotiEJAv1ucXvc7G7TuX